CVE-2011-4758

17
FAUCET Score

CVE-2011-4758 describes a cleartext password vulnerability in Parallels Plesk Small Business Panel 10.2.0, where user credentials are transmitted over unencrypted HTTP connections. This allows remote attackers to intercept sensitive information via network sniffing.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 5.0, indicating a medium severity with low attack complexity and potential for confidentiality compromise.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
